📋 Directions for Use

Directions: For adults, mix one (1) scoop (45g) of powder with 6 oz. of cold water or milk. You can take MET-Rx(R) MyoSynthesis Whey any time during the day when you need nutritional support, especially to increase your daily caloric/protein intake. Consume within 10 minutes after mixing for best results. Blender – Simple Add one scoop of MET-Rx(R) MyoSynthesis Whey to blender filled with 6-8 ounces of your favorite beverage. Cover and blend for 20-30 seconds. For a delicious smoothie, add peanut butter, fruit, or yogurt along with ice cubes. Shaker – Simpler Fill a shaker bottle with 6-8 ounces of your favorite beverage. Add one scoop of MET-Rx(R) MyoSynthesis Whey. Cover and shake for 25-30 seconds. Glass & Spoon – Simplest Add one scoop of MET-Rx(R) MyoSynthesis Whey to 6-8 ounces of your favorite beverage. Stir for 20-30 seconds or until completely blended. ^^ For Mass Gaining: add higher calorie foods such as peanut butter, 1-2% milk, and fruit juices. For Dieters: add lower calorie foods such as skim milk, blueberries, and raspberries, or just use water.

⚠️ Warnings & Precautions

Avoid this product if you have kidney disease. Discontinue use and consult your doctor if any adverse reactions occur.

Not intended for use by persons under the age of 18. KEEP OUT OF REACH OF CHILDREN.

TAMPER RESISTANT: DO NOT USE IF SEAL UNDER CAP IS BROKEN OR MISSING.

Contains milk and soy ingredients.

NOTICE: Use this product as a food supplement only. Do not use for weight reduction.

WARNING: Not intended for use by pregnant or nursing women. If you are taking any medications or have any medical condition, consult your doctor before use.
